import request from '@/config/axios' //agv 下载 export const agvDownload = async (params) => { return await request.download({ url: `/system/position-map/agvDownload`, params }) } //点位地图列表 export const getPositionMapList = async (params) => { return await request.get({ url: `/system/position-map/list`, params }) } //删除车辆信息 export const deleteRobotInformation = async (id: number) => { return await request.delete({ url: `/system/robot/information/delete?id=` + id }) } //查询所有车辆 export const getAllRobot = async (data) => { return await request.post({ url: `/system/robot/information/getAllRobot`, data }) } //获得车辆信息 详情 export const getRobotInformation = async (params) => { return await request.get({ url: `/system/robot/information/get`, params }) } //分页查询车辆列表 看板信息车辆目前用的是这个 export const robotInformationPage = async (params) => { return await request.get({ url: `/system/robot/information/page`, params }) } //统计车辆待命-任务中-离线 export const robotInformationStatistics = async (data) => { return await request.post({ url: `/system/robot/information/statistics`, data }) } // 创建车辆信息 export const robotInformationCreate = async (data) => { return await request.post({ url: `/system/robot/information/create`, data }) } // 编辑车辆信息 export const robotInformationUpdate = async (data) => { return await request.put({ url: `/system/robot/information/update`, data }) } //分页查询车辆列表 看板信息车辆目前用的是这个 export const robotGetAllModel = async (params) => { return await request.get({ url: `/system/robot/model/getAllModel`, params }) } // 范围选择 export const robotPositionGetMap = async (params) => { return await request.get({ url: `/system/position-map/getMap`, params }) } // 完整范围选择 export const robotPositionGetMapAll = async (params) => { return await request.get({ url: `/system/position-map/getAllMap`, params }) } // 完整范围选择 修改成这个了 车辆那边 export const robotPositionGetMapAllNew = async (params) => { return await request.get({ url: `/system/position-map/getMap`, params }) } //获得车辆列表 新 export const getRobotInformationList = async (params) => { return await request.get({ url: `/system/robot/information/list`, params }) } // 清除交管 export const cleanTrafficManagement = async (data) => { return await request.post({ url: `/system/robot/information/cleanTrafficManagement?robotNo=${data.robotNo}`, data }) } // 恢复任务 export const doTaskContinue = async (data) => { return await request.post({ url: `/system/robot/information/doTaskContinue?robotNo=${data.robotNo}`, data }) }